I'm also comfused by your question.  I guess this comes down to your definition of "modular".  The unit you've identified is only "modular" in that it's made from a single piece of aluminum.  Other than that it's a tradiional upper, you have to install a barrel the traditional way.  If your intent was to buy something similar to the MGI Modular upper or the LMT Monolithic, where you can quick change barrels, then you are barking up the wrong tree.  

How do you define "modular"?
